Intellectual Property Citation & Licensing

Licensing and Citation Policy

Monadnock Research (MR) is an independent provider of objective syndicated and custom research, and other forms of editorial content (intellectual property, or "IP"), primarily for its clients' internal use.

MR content is not made available to the general public in any library or research institution. All published material is protected by U.S. copyrights (see The United States Code, Title 17, Copyright Law of the U.S.A.) and through international reciprocity agreements governing intellectual property.

No fair use of MR IP can be asserted, except for properly cited works that MR has authorized via license to clients; or by authorized release for republication to research partners; or releases to representatives of the press for promotional purposes. For more information on why fair use is not otherwise authorized by MR and cannot be lawfully asserted, please refer to the Report IP Violations section of this site.

Members of the press, clients, and other stakeholders often request to cite information contained in our publications. This document details our citation and content licensing policies.

Press and General Guidelines

Members of the press, and other contractually authorized parties, may use material created by MR provided that:

  • The text cites MR as the source

  • The Monadnock Research copyright statement and month/year of publication is affixed to all graphics, diagrams, graphs, and/or tables as "© Monadnock Research, Month Year"

  • When quoting an analyst, consultant, or executive, use the full name and title of the analyst, and source Monadnock Research as the firm

  • No published research provided to members of the Press by Monadnock Research for background should be reproduced in its entirety, or circulated internally or externally, except as required for in-scope one-off editorial purposes. If you require further clarification please contact us prior to circulation or publication.

  • When using the Monadnock Research company name within a press release, article, report, or feature, please ensure that it cites: "independent analyst, Monadnock Research"

  • Citations must be accurate and quoted verbatim within the context of their original intended use, without adaptation, manipulation, paraphrasing, or summarization if possible.

  • The amount of published text should not exceed a standard paragraph when quoted verbatim.

  • Quotes or extracts must not be used to criticize any individual or entity's capabilities, products, or services.

MR Enterprise Clients and PR Agencies Representing MR Clients

Enterprise clients are organizations that pay an annual fee to license the entire MR content portfolio. Limited citation rights are included with that license. Client-specific agreement terms and conditions may override guidance provided here, and may expand or limit citation privileges.

Clients, and PR Agencies working on behalf of enterprise clients, may use limited and insubstantial written extracts from published research they have licensed for internal and external use, provided that: such use is in the ordinary course of business; does not form part of a regular or routine pattern of use; and is only used by, or on behalf of, the MR client organization that has licensed the content, and only during the license period.

Clients, including PR Agencies working on behalf of enterprise clients, may reproduce a diagram, graph, or table for use in marketing collateral per the General Citation Guidelines.

All Clients and PR Agencies should obtain approval from Monadnock Research for the following requests:

  • Where reproduction and/or distribution of a specific piece of content is required.

  • Where a verbal quotation or written material is intended for use in any form of marketing collateral or publicly available information.

  • Where the amount of text from any Monadnock Research publication exceeds a standard paragraph when quoted verbatim.

  • When use of the Monadnock Research company name within the headline or sub-head of a press release, article, or feature is contemplated.
A copy of the document to be released or quoted, or a relevant section, must be provided for us to provide authorization for a specific use.

Non-Clients

Monadnock Research content may be cited under certain circumstances, usually for a fee, provided that the citation guidelines are adhered-to, and prior written approval from Monadnock Research has been received for the specific intended use.

Monadnock Research Copyrights

Monadnock Research publications are proprietary and subject to copyright and proprietary material protections under US and international law, treaties, and reciprocity agreements. Commercial use of Monadnock Research publications is strictly prohibited.

Approval Process

Please contact us with requests for approval. Requests are typically addressed within two business days of receipt. If your request must be expedited, contact us via phone at the number noted on the Contact page.
